May Weather in Arcadia Lakes,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In May, the average temperature in Arcadia Lakes, United States is a pleasant 23°C (74°F). Expect to experience a range from a cool 7°C (44°F) to a warm 37°C (99°F). The region sees about 105 mm (4.1 in) of precipitation over approximately 9 days, contributing to an average humidity of 75%. How May Weather in Arcadia Lakes Compares to Other Months

Weather in Arcadia Lakes var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ares May’s weather to other months in Arcadia Lakes,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Arcadia Lakes, showing how May’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ather9°C (48°F)86 mm (3.4 inches)86%moderate
February Weather12°C (53°F)103 mm (4.1 inches)81%high
March Weather14°C (58°F)75 mm (2.9 inches)81%very high
April Weather18°C (65°F)108 mm (4.2 inches)79%very high
May Weather23°C (74°F)105 mm (4.1 inches)75%very high
June Weather26°C (79°F)110 mm (4.3 inches)75%extreme
July Weather27°C (82°F)139 mm (5.5 inches)80%extreme
August Weather27°C (80°F)134 mm (5.3 inches)81%extreme
September Weather25°C (77°F)100 mm (4.0 inches)83%very high
October Weather20°C (69°F)73 mm (2.9 inches)78%very high
November Weather13°C (55°F)66 mm (2.6 inches)85%high
December Weather10°C (51°F)130 mm (5.1 inches)87%moderate
